National Route 279 is a national highway of Japan that connects Hakodate, Hokkaidō and Noheji, Aomori in Japan, with a total length of 107 km (66.49 mi). The highway, along with National Route 338, crosses the Tsugaru Strait by ferry from Hakodate to Oma, Aomori.
